About me

Patricia Alexander-Galvin, LPC has been providing counseling and mental health services for over 40 years. She has a depth of insight and compassion across generations and experiences. Ms. Alexander-Galvin is an expert in offering individual, couples, families and group counseling sessions. Some specialties include anger management, depression and anxiety, goal setting, chemical dependency, geriatrics, youth and young adults, trauma, parenting, coping, crisis and vocational rehabilitation. As a graduate of Prairie View A&M University’s Masters in Counseling program, Ms. Alexander-Galvin has been providing independent counseling since 2007 through Refreshing Springs Counseling Services.
